Polling Peacefully Concludes in Bihar for Six Nagar Panchayats and 36 Municipal By-Elections.

In Bihar, polling was peacefully concluded today for general election in six Nagar Panchayats and by-poll in 36 other municipal bodies. According to the State Election Commission, an estimated 62.41 percent voter turnout was recorded in the polling held.


With this election Bihar successfully conducted the process of e-Voting system using mobile based applications. Talking to Akashvani News, State Election Commissioner Dipak Prasad said that the voter turnout for e-Voting was more than 70 percent.

Mr. Prasad said compared to polling booths voting more voters come forward to exercise their right to franchise. At polling booths 54.63 percent polling was recorded.

Mr. Prasad said the successful implementation of today’s in Bihar in municipal bodies elections the e-Voting has opened future avenues and revolutionary reforms in the process of voting.

Electoral fate of a total 538 candidates for Chief Councillor, Deputy Chief Councillor and other posts of municipal bodies were sealed in EVMs today.  The counting of votes will be held on 30th June.
